Our handcrafted White Pine log siding features “D”-shaped logs with beveled edges, measuring 3” thick by 8”, 10” or 12” wide. Our logs are milled, planed, and treated with fungicide, and can also be pre-finished with stain and UV protection to your specifications.

Installation: 3-5 days, depending on amount log siding to be installed.
Average Cost: $7 to $9.25 / lineal ft., depending on the width of the log siding.
As an alternative to full log siding, we can also build wraparound corner posts for your home. All of our log posts are 12” in diameter and are cut to fit snugly around the corners of your home.
Installation: 1-2 days.
Average Cost: $80 / piece.
